My CA Driver's license was revoked here. If i move out of state can I get one there?
-
I got too many tickets and then never paid them here in California so my license was taken. I am planning to move out of state at some point, would I be able to get a license there even though I haven't paid my tickets off here.

Sure you can. Just as soon as CA restores your driving privilege.
Scott H
No, all the DMVs are connected by computer and they share this information.
